##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2011-06-23** Ch. SL 2011-232 `became-law`
- **2011-06-23** Signed By Gov. 6/23/2011 `executive-signature`
- **2011-06-16** Pres. To Gov. 6/16/2011 `executive-receipt`
- **2011-06-15** Ratified
- **2011-06-14** Passed 3rd Reading `passage, reading-3`
- **2011-06-14** Passed 2nd Reading `reading-2`
- **2011-06-14** Placed On Cal For 6/14/2011
- **2011-06-14** Reptd Fav `committee-passage-favorable`
- **2011-06-10** Ref To Com On Pensions & Retirement and Aging `referral-committee`
- **2011-06-10** Passed 1st Reading `reading-1`
- **2011-06-10** Rec From House
- **2011-06-09** Passed 3rd Reading `passage, reading-3`
- **2011-06-08** Passed 2nd Reading `reading-2`
- **2011-06-08** Placed On Cal For 6/8/2011
- **2011-06-08** Cal Pursuant Rule 36(b)
- **2011-06-08** Referral to Approprations Stricken
- **2011-06-08** Serial Referral to Finance Stricken
- **2011-06-08** Reptd Fav Com Substitute `committee-passage-favorable`
- **2011-05-05** Ref to the Com on State Personnel, if favorable, Finance `referral-committee`
- **2011-05-05** Passed 1st Reading `reading-1`
- **2011-05-04** Filed `introduction`
